Resume and JobRESUME AND JOB
JP Morgan Chase logo

Software Engineer II -Golang & Kubernetes

JP Morgan Chase

Software and Technology Jobs

Software Engineer II -Golang & Kubernetes

full-timePosted: Dec 5, 2025

Job Description

Software Engineer II -Golang & Kubernetes

Location: Bengaluru, Karnataka, India

Job Family: Software Engineering

About the Role

At JPMorgan Chase, we are at the forefront of financial innovation, leveraging cutting-edge technology to power everything from global payments to sophisticated risk analytics. As a Software Engineer II specializing in Golang and Kubernetes, you will join an agile team in our Bengaluru technology hub, contributing to the design and delivery of secure, scalable products that drive our market-leading services. In this role, you will build resilient backend systems that handle high-volume transactions, ensuring compliance with stringent financial regulations while enhancing operational efficiency for our clients worldwide. Your day-to-day will involve collaborating with product managers, data scientists, and fellow engineers to architect microservices-based solutions using Golang, deployed seamlessly on Kubernetes clusters. You will focus on creating low-latency, fault-tolerant applications that support core banking functions like asset management and cybersecurity. By participating in agile sprints, you will iterate rapidly on features, conduct thorough testing, and optimize for performance, all while upholding JPMorgan's commitment to data privacy and ethical AI practices in the financial sector. This position offers a unique opportunity to grow within one of the world's largest financial institutions, where your technical expertise will directly impact millions of customers. We value diverse perspectives and foster an inclusive environment that encourages innovation and professional development. Join us in Bengaluru to shape the future of finance through technology.

Key Responsibilities

  • Design, develop, and maintain high-performance applications using Golang to support JPMorgan Chase's global financial platforms
  • Implement and manage containerized applications on Kubernetes, ensuring scalability and reliability for mission-critical banking services
  • Collaborate with cross-functional agile teams to deliver secure, innovative technology solutions that enhance client experiences in wealth management and investment banking
  • Conduct code reviews, unit testing, and integration testing to uphold the highest standards of code quality and security compliance
  • Troubleshoot and optimize system performance, focusing on low-latency requirements for real-time financial transactions
  • Integrate with internal APIs and third-party services to build robust, data-driven features for risk assessment and fraud detection
  • Participate in sprint planning and retrospectives to continuously improve development processes within JPMorgan's engineering culture
  • Ensure adherence to regulatory standards such as GDPR and SOX in all software deliverables
  • Mentor junior engineers and contribute to knowledge-sharing initiatives across the technology organization

Required Qualifications

  • Bachelor's degree in Computer Science, Engineering, or a related field
  • 2-5 years of professional software development experience
  • Proficiency in Golang for building scalable backend services
  • Hands-on experience with Kubernetes for container orchestration and deployment
  • Strong understanding of agile methodologies and collaborative team environments
  • Experience in secure coding practices, especially in financial systems handling sensitive data

Preferred Qualifications

  • Experience in the financial services industry, particularly with trading or risk management systems
  • Familiarity with cloud platforms like AWS or Azure in a regulated environment
  • Knowledge of microservices architecture and CI/CD pipelines
  • Certifications such as Certified Kubernetes Administrator (CKA)

Required Skills

  • Golang programming expertise
  • Kubernetes orchestration and management
  • Microservices design and implementation
  • Agile development practices
  • Secure coding and vulnerability assessment
  • Cloud computing fundamentals (AWS/GCP)
  • API development and integration
  • Unit and integration testing frameworks
  • Problem-solving in high-stakes environments
  • Collaboration and communication skills
  • Version control with Git
  • CI/CD pipeline automation
  • Database management (SQL/NoSQL)
  • Performance optimization techniques
  • Financial domain knowledge (e.g., trading systems)

Benefits

  • Competitive base salary and performance-based bonuses aligned with financial industry standards
  • Comprehensive health, dental, and vision insurance coverage for employees and families
  • Retirement savings plan with generous company matching contributions
  • Paid time off, including vacation, sick leave, and parental leave policies
  • Professional development opportunities, such as tuition reimbursement and access to JPMorgan's internal training programs
  • Employee wellness programs, including gym memberships and mental health support
  • Flexible work arrangements, including hybrid options in Bengaluru
  • Stock purchase plan and other financial perks tailored to the banking sector

JP Morgan Chase is an equal opportunity employer.

Locations

  • Bengaluru, IN

Salary

Estimated Salary Rangehigh confidence

25,000,000 - 45,000,000 INR /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Golang programming expertiseintermediate
  • Kubernetes orchestration and managementintermediate
  • Microservices design and implementationintermediate
  • Agile development practicesintermediate
  • Secure coding and vulnerability assessmentintermediate
  • Cloud computing fundamentals (AWS/GCP)intermediate
  • API development and integrationintermediate
  • Unit and integration testing frameworksintermediate
  • Problem-solving in high-stakes environmentsintermediate
  • Collaboration and communication skillsintermediate
  • Version control with Gitintermediate
  • CI/CD pipeline automationintermediate
  • Database management (SQL/NoSQL)intermediate
  • Performance optimization techniquesintermediate
  • Financial domain knowledge (e.g., trading systems)intermediate

Required Qualifications

  • Bachelor's degree in Computer Science, Engineering, or a related field (experience)
  • 2-5 years of professional software development experience (experience)
  • Proficiency in Golang for building scalable backend services (experience)
  • Hands-on experience with Kubernetes for container orchestration and deployment (experience)
  • Strong understanding of agile methodologies and collaborative team environments (experience)
  • Experience in secure coding practices, especially in financial systems handling sensitive data (experience)

Preferred Qualifications

  • Experience in the financial services industry, particularly with trading or risk management systems (experience)
  • Familiarity with cloud platforms like AWS or Azure in a regulated environment (experience)
  • Knowledge of microservices architecture and CI/CD pipelines (experience)
  • Certifications such as Certified Kubernetes Administrator (CKA) (experience)

Responsibilities

  • Design, develop, and maintain high-performance applications using Golang to support JPMorgan Chase's global financial platforms
  • Implement and manage containerized applications on Kubernetes, ensuring scalability and reliability for mission-critical banking services
  • Collaborate with cross-functional agile teams to deliver secure, innovative technology solutions that enhance client experiences in wealth management and investment banking
  • Conduct code reviews, unit testing, and integration testing to uphold the highest standards of code quality and security compliance
  • Troubleshoot and optimize system performance, focusing on low-latency requirements for real-time financial transactions
  • Integrate with internal APIs and third-party services to build robust, data-driven features for risk assessment and fraud detection
  • Participate in sprint planning and retrospectives to continuously improve development processes within JPMorgan's engineering culture
  • Ensure adherence to regulatory standards such as GDPR and SOX in all software deliverables
  • Mentor junior engineers and contribute to knowledge-sharing initiatives across the technology organization

Benefits

  • general: Competitive base salary and performance-based bonuses aligned with financial industry standards
  • general: Comprehensive health, dental, and vision insurance coverage for employees and families
  • general: Retirement savings plan with generous company matching contributions
  • general: Paid time off, including vacation, sick leave, and parental leave policies
  • general: Professional development opportunities, such as tuition reimbursement and access to JPMorgan's internal training programs
  • general: Employee wellness programs, including gym memberships and mental health support
  • general: Flexible work arrangements, including hybrid options in Bengaluru
  • general: Stock purchase plan and other financial perks tailored to the banking sector

Target Your Resume for "Software Engineer II -Golang & Kubernetes" , JP Morgan Chase

Get personalized recommendations to optimize your resume specifically for Software Engineer II -Golang & Kubernetes.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Software Engineer II -Golang & Kubernetes" , JP Morgan Chase

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

Software EngineeringFinancial ServicesBankingJP MorganSoftware Engineering

Answer 10 quick questions to check your fit for Software Engineer II -Golang & Kubernetes @ JP Morgan Chase.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.

JP Morgan Chase logo

Software Engineer II -Golang & Kubernetes

JP Morgan Chase

Software and Technology Jobs

Software Engineer II -Golang & Kubernetes

full-timePosted: Dec 5, 2025

Job Description

Software Engineer II -Golang & Kubernetes

Location: Bengaluru, Karnataka, India

Job Family: Software Engineering

About the Role

At JPMorgan Chase, we are at the forefront of financial innovation, leveraging cutting-edge technology to power everything from global payments to sophisticated risk analytics. As a Software Engineer II specializing in Golang and Kubernetes, you will join an agile team in our Bengaluru technology hub, contributing to the design and delivery of secure, scalable products that drive our market-leading services. In this role, you will build resilient backend systems that handle high-volume transactions, ensuring compliance with stringent financial regulations while enhancing operational efficiency for our clients worldwide. Your day-to-day will involve collaborating with product managers, data scientists, and fellow engineers to architect microservices-based solutions using Golang, deployed seamlessly on Kubernetes clusters. You will focus on creating low-latency, fault-tolerant applications that support core banking functions like asset management and cybersecurity. By participating in agile sprints, you will iterate rapidly on features, conduct thorough testing, and optimize for performance, all while upholding JPMorgan's commitment to data privacy and ethical AI practices in the financial sector. This position offers a unique opportunity to grow within one of the world's largest financial institutions, where your technical expertise will directly impact millions of customers. We value diverse perspectives and foster an inclusive environment that encourages innovation and professional development. Join us in Bengaluru to shape the future of finance through technology.

Key Responsibilities

  • Design, develop, and maintain high-performance applications using Golang to support JPMorgan Chase's global financial platforms
  • Implement and manage containerized applications on Kubernetes, ensuring scalability and reliability for mission-critical banking services
  • Collaborate with cross-functional agile teams to deliver secure, innovative technology solutions that enhance client experiences in wealth management and investment banking
  • Conduct code reviews, unit testing, and integration testing to uphold the highest standards of code quality and security compliance
  • Troubleshoot and optimize system performance, focusing on low-latency requirements for real-time financial transactions
  • Integrate with internal APIs and third-party services to build robust, data-driven features for risk assessment and fraud detection
  • Participate in sprint planning and retrospectives to continuously improve development processes within JPMorgan's engineering culture
  • Ensure adherence to regulatory standards such as GDPR and SOX in all software deliverables
  • Mentor junior engineers and contribute to knowledge-sharing initiatives across the technology organization

Required Qualifications

  • Bachelor's degree in Computer Science, Engineering, or a related field
  • 2-5 years of professional software development experience
  • Proficiency in Golang for building scalable backend services
  • Hands-on experience with Kubernetes for container orchestration and deployment
  • Strong understanding of agile methodologies and collaborative team environments
  • Experience in secure coding practices, especially in financial systems handling sensitive data

Preferred Qualifications

  • Experience in the financial services industry, particularly with trading or risk management systems
  • Familiarity with cloud platforms like AWS or Azure in a regulated environment
  • Knowledge of microservices architecture and CI/CD pipelines
  • Certifications such as Certified Kubernetes Administrator (CKA)

Required Skills

  • Golang programming expertise
  • Kubernetes orchestration and management
  • Microservices design and implementation
  • Agile development practices
  • Secure coding and vulnerability assessment
  • Cloud computing fundamentals (AWS/GCP)
  • API development and integration
  • Unit and integration testing frameworks
  • Problem-solving in high-stakes environments
  • Collaboration and communication skills
  • Version control with Git
  • CI/CD pipeline automation
  • Database management (SQL/NoSQL)
  • Performance optimization techniques
  • Financial domain knowledge (e.g., trading systems)

Benefits

  • Competitive base salary and performance-based bonuses aligned with financial industry standards
  • Comprehensive health, dental, and vision insurance coverage for employees and families
  • Retirement savings plan with generous company matching contributions
  • Paid time off, including vacation, sick leave, and parental leave policies
  • Professional development opportunities, such as tuition reimbursement and access to JPMorgan's internal training programs
  • Employee wellness programs, including gym memberships and mental health support
  • Flexible work arrangements, including hybrid options in Bengaluru
  • Stock purchase plan and other financial perks tailored to the banking sector

JP Morgan Chase is an equal opportunity employer.

Locations

  • Bengaluru, IN

Salary

Estimated Salary Rangehigh confidence

25,000,000 - 45,000,000 INR / yearly

Source: ai estimated

* This is an estimated range based on market data and may vary based on experience and qualifications.

Skills Required

  • Golang programming expertiseintermediate
  • Kubernetes orchestration and managementintermediate
  • Microservices design and implementationintermediate
  • Agile development practicesintermediate
  • Secure coding and vulnerability assessmentintermediate
  • Cloud computing fundamentals (AWS/GCP)intermediate
  • API development and integrationintermediate
  • Unit and integration testing frameworksintermediate
  • Problem-solving in high-stakes environmentsintermediate
  • Collaboration and communication skillsintermediate
  • Version control with Gitintermediate
  • CI/CD pipeline automationintermediate
  • Database management (SQL/NoSQL)intermediate
  • Performance optimization techniquesintermediate
  • Financial domain knowledge (e.g., trading systems)intermediate

Required Qualifications

  • Bachelor's degree in Computer Science, Engineering, or a related field (experience)
  • 2-5 years of professional software development experience (experience)
  • Proficiency in Golang for building scalable backend services (experience)
  • Hands-on experience with Kubernetes for container orchestration and deployment (experience)
  • Strong understanding of agile methodologies and collaborative team environments (experience)
  • Experience in secure coding practices, especially in financial systems handling sensitive data (experience)

Preferred Qualifications

  • Experience in the financial services industry, particularly with trading or risk management systems (experience)
  • Familiarity with cloud platforms like AWS or Azure in a regulated environment (experience)
  • Knowledge of microservices architecture and CI/CD pipelines (experience)
  • Certifications such as Certified Kubernetes Administrator (CKA) (experience)

Responsibilities

  • Design, develop, and maintain high-performance applications using Golang to support JPMorgan Chase's global financial platforms
  • Implement and manage containerized applications on Kubernetes, ensuring scalability and reliability for mission-critical banking services
  • Collaborate with cross-functional agile teams to deliver secure, innovative technology solutions that enhance client experiences in wealth management and investment banking
  • Conduct code reviews, unit testing, and integration testing to uphold the highest standards of code quality and security compliance
  • Troubleshoot and optimize system performance, focusing on low-latency requirements for real-time financial transactions
  • Integrate with internal APIs and third-party services to build robust, data-driven features for risk assessment and fraud detection
  • Participate in sprint planning and retrospectives to continuously improve development processes within JPMorgan's engineering culture
  • Ensure adherence to regulatory standards such as GDPR and SOX in all software deliverables
  • Mentor junior engineers and contribute to knowledge-sharing initiatives across the technology organization

Benefits

  • general: Competitive base salary and performance-based bonuses aligned with financial industry standards
  • general: Comprehensive health, dental, and vision insurance coverage for employees and families
  • general: Retirement savings plan with generous company matching contributions
  • general: Paid time off, including vacation, sick leave, and parental leave policies
  • general: Professional development opportunities, such as tuition reimbursement and access to JPMorgan's internal training programs
  • general: Employee wellness programs, including gym memberships and mental health support
  • general: Flexible work arrangements, including hybrid options in Bengaluru
  • general: Stock purchase plan and other financial perks tailored to the banking sector

Target Your Resume for "Software Engineer II -Golang & Kubernetes" , JP Morgan Chase

Get personalized recommendations to optimize your resume specifically for Software Engineer II -Golang & Kubernetes. Takes only 15 seconds!

AI-powered keyword optimization
Skills matching & gap analysis
Experience alignment suggestions

Check Your ATS Score for "Software Engineer II -Golang & Kubernetes" , JP Morgan Chase

Find out how well your resume matches this job's requirements. Get comprehensive analysis including ATS compatibility, keyword matching, skill gaps, and personalized recommendations.

ATS compatibility check
Keyword optimization analysis
Skill matching & gap identification
Format & readability score

Tags & Categories

Software EngineeringFinancial ServicesBankingJP MorganSoftware Engineering

Answer 10 quick questions to check your fit for Software Engineer II -Golang & Kubernetes @ JP Morgan Chase.

Quiz Challenge
10 Questions
~2 Minutes
Instant Score

Related Books and Jobs

No related jobs found at the moment.